IP Settings section - Configuring a Static IP Address over Ethernet

1.

Select Protected Setup > System Settings (located on the lower-left) to open the System Settings page.

2.

Locate the IP Settings section of this page.

3.

Toggle the DHCP/Static field (from the IP Settings section) until the choice cycles to Static.

4.

Press the IP Address field to open a Keyboard and enter the Static IP Address (provided by your System
Administrator
).

5.

Press Done after you are finished entering the IP information.

6.

Repeat the same process for the Subnet Mask and Gateway fields.

7.

Press the optional Host Name field to open the Keyboard and enter the Host Name information.

8.

Press Done after you are finished assigning the alpha-numeric string of the host name.

9.

Press the Primary DNS field to open a Keyboard, enter the Primary DNS Address (provided by your
System Administrator) and press Done when compete. Repeat this process for the Secondary DNS field.

10.

Press the Domain field to open a Keyboard, enter the resolvable domain Address (this is provided by your
System Administrator and equates to a unique Internet name for the panel
), and press Done when
complete.

11.

Navigate to the Master Connection section of this page to begin configuring the communication
parameters for the target Master.

Even though the Host, Gateway, Primary DNS, Secondary DNS, and Domain fields
appear on the two separate System Settings and Wireless Settings pages; the
information populating these fields is identical.
If the information within one of these fields is altered, the change is reflected on both
pages within the altered field.
Example: Domain is altered on Wireless Settings page, the value is then also
changed within the Domain field of the System Settings page.

DHCP will register the unique MAC Address (factory assigned) on the panel and
once the communication setup process is complete, reserve an IP Address, Subnet
Mask, and Gateway values from the DHCP Server.
